In today's digital landscape, understanding how to improve your website's rankings is crucial for success. With millions of websites competing for attention, leveraging the right tools and techniques can set you apart from the competition. One of the most effective ways to gain insights into your website's performance and optimize your rankings is through the use of APIs. In this article, we will explore how APIs can significantly enhance your website's SEO strategies and overall performance.
APIs, or Application Programming Interfaces, play a pivotal role in accessing and analyzing data from various sources. By integrating these APIs into your website, you can gather vital information that will help you make informed decisions to improve your search engine rankings. From keyword analysis to backlink tracking, APIs provide a wealth of data that can be harnessed to develop a robust SEO strategy.
This comprehensive guide will delve into the various types of APIs available for website rankings, how they work, and how you can implement them effectively. Whether you're a seasoned SEO professional or a business owner looking to enhance your online presence, this article is tailored to equip you with the knowledge needed to leverage APIs for your website's success.
Table of Contents
- What is an API?
- The Importance of APIs in SEO
- Types of SEO APIs
- How to Implement APIs for Your Website
- Best Practices for Using APIs
- Case Studies: Successful API Implementation
- The Future of APIs in SEO
- Conclusion
What is an API?
An API, or Application Programming Interface, is a set of rules and protocols that allows different software applications to communicate with each other. In the context of website rankings and SEO, APIs enable you to access and utilize data from various platforms, such as search engines and analytics tools. By integrating APIs into your website, you can automate processes, gather insights, and make data-driven decisions to improve your SEO efforts.
The Importance of APIs in SEO
APIs are essential for modern SEO practices, as they provide access to valuable data that can inform your strategies. Here are some key reasons why APIs are important for SEO:
- Data Access: APIs allow you to access large datasets that can help you understand user behavior, search trends, and competitor strategies.
- Automation: With APIs, you can automate repetitive tasks, such as data collection and reporting, freeing up time for more strategic activities.
- Real-Time Insights: APIs provide real-time data, enabling you to make timely decisions and adjustments to your SEO strategies.
- Integration: APIs facilitate the integration of different tools and platforms, creating a seamless workflow for your SEO efforts.
Types of SEO APIs
There are several types of APIs that can be beneficial for your SEO efforts. Below, we will explore four key categories of SEO APIs.
Keyword Research APIs
Keyword research is a fundamental aspect of SEO, and utilizing keyword research APIs can help you uncover valuable insights. These APIs provide data on search volumes, keyword difficulty, and related keywords, allowing you to identify high-potential keywords for your content. Popular keyword research APIs include:
- Google Keyword Planner API
- SEMrush API
- Ahrefs API
- Moz Keyword Explorer API
Backlink Analysis APIs
Backlinks are a critical factor in determining your website's authority and rankings. Backlink analysis APIs enable you to monitor your backlink profile and analyze your competitors' backlinks. This information can help you identify link-building opportunities and improve your overall SEO strategy. Notable backlink analysis APIs include:
- Ahrefs API
- Majestic API
- SEMrush Backlink API
Rank Tracking APIs
Rank tracking APIs allow you to monitor your website's rankings for specific keywords over time. These APIs provide insights into your ranking performance and help you identify trends and areas for improvement. Some popular rank tracking APIs are:
- Rank Ranger API
- AccuRanker API
- SEMrush Rank Tracking API
Site Audit APIs
Regular site audits are essential for maintaining a healthy website. Site audit APIs help you identify technical issues, on-page SEO factors, and overall site performance. These insights can guide your optimization efforts. Key site audit APIs include:
- SEMrush Site Audit API
- Ahrefs Site Audit API
- Sitebulb API
How to Implement APIs for Your Website
Implementing APIs into your website requires a systematic approach. Here are the steps to effectively integrate APIs:
- Identify Your Goals: Determine what you want to achieve with the API integration, whether it's keyword research, backlink analysis, or rank tracking.
- Choose the Right APIs: Based on your goals, select the most relevant APIs that provide the data you need.
- Obtain API Keys: Sign up for the selected APIs and obtain your unique API keys to authenticate your requests.
- Integrate the APIs: Use programming languages such as Python, JavaScript, or PHP to integrate the APIs into your website.
- Analyze Data: Regularly analyze the data collected from the APIs to inform your SEO strategies.
Best Practices for Using APIs
To maximize the benefits of APIs for your website rankings, consider the following best practices:
- Stay Updated: Regularly check for updates and changes to the APIs you are using to ensure compatibility and access to the latest features.
- Optimize API Calls: Limit the number of API calls to avoid hitting rate limits and ensure efficient data retrieval.
- Secure Your API Keys: Keep your API keys secure and avoid exposing them publicly to prevent unauthorized access.
- Document Your Integration: Maintain clear documentation of your API integrations for future reference and troubleshooting.
Case Studies: Successful API Implementation
Several companies have successfully leveraged APIs to enhance their SEO efforts. Here are two notable case studies:
Case Study 1: E-commerce Website
An e-commerce website utilized a combination of keyword research and rank tracking APIs to improve its product page rankings. By identifying high-volume keywords and monitoring their rankings over time, the website was able to optimize its content and increase organic traffic by 45% within six months.
Case Study 2: Content Marketing Agency
A content marketing agency integrated backlink analysis APIs to monitor their clients' backlink profiles. By identifying toxic backlinks and discovering new link-building opportunities, the agency improved its clients' domain authority and increased referral traffic by 30% within four months.
The Future of APIs in SEO
The future of APIs in SEO looks promising as technology continues to evolve. With advancements in artificial intelligence and machine learning, APIs will likely become more sophisticated, providing deeper insights and automation capabilities. As search engines become more complex, leveraging APIs will be essential for staying ahead of the competition and adapting to changing algorithms.
Conclusion
In conclusion, integrating APIs into your website's SEO strategy can unlock powerful insights and drive improvements in your rankings. By understanding the various types of APIs available and how to implement them effectively, you can make data-driven decisions that enhance your online presence.